Operation Mom – Impending launch
OpMom is taking email addresses to let you know when they will launch. From what I can gather, it’s to “Share, Meet, Schedule and More!” for moms. This Texas, Houston based start up’s parent company is TriTaur who are developing Web 2.0 based applications and OpMom is their flagship product.

Minti – launches Groups and Forums
As a co-founder of Minti, I am happy to mention that we’ve just launched with Groups and Forums…
Minti just got another update and here are a few of the key improvements to the site :
- Groups have been added – There are:
- public groups (such as for each country and for parents with children born in the same year) – where members can contribute to a collborative blog or chat via a group conversations.
- private groups which any member can form and then invite others to join into their own private area. Maybe you have a parenting group you are a member of and you want a private place to make posts in a blog format or chat with one another about the latest goings on in the conversation area- start your own group and be the administrator and controller of who gets to join in.
- Forums have been added – you can now chat about a range of topics organised into popular forums
- Daily emails are now available summarising activity on articles, blogs or by members who are on your “watch list” – these emails are relevant to your requirements and the watch list is easy to edit if you are receiving too much detail
- There is a new Blog calendar to help you track your blog entries by date and make it easy to recall when you made your last Blog update
- There are some pretty flags next to the member names to make countries clearer
- We have revised the ranking formula to make it more likely for those participating actively in the site to improve their ranking (through advice, voting, comments and regular visits)
- The Member’s menu’s have been simplified and the look of the member homepages revised.
